How Do Gift Card Programs Work?

woman with a laptop surrounded by a credit card ready to shop due to Employee Gift Card Programs, present box, snag (a type of decorative fabric), and fairy lights

Gift card programs are a popular way for companies to reward their employees for their hard work and dedication. These programs provide a convenient and flexible way for employees to choose their own rewards, while also offering benefits to the employers. In this section, we will dive into the details of how gift card programs work and the various aspects to consider.

1. Types of Gift Card Programs

  • Incentive Programs: These programs are designed to motivate employees by providing them with gift cards as rewards for meeting specific goals or achieving certain milestones.
  • Recognition Programs: Recognition programs aim to acknowledge and appreciate employees for their outstanding performance or contributions. Gift cards are used as a token of appreciation in these programs.
  • Service Anniversary Programs: These programs celebrate the loyalty and dedication of employees who have been with the company for a certain number of years. Gift cards are often given as a sign of gratitude on these milestones.

2. Choosing the Right Gift Card Provider

When implementing a gift card program, it is essential to partner with a reputable gift card provider. Look for providers that offer a wide variety of gift card options, including popular retailers, restaurants, and online platforms. Additionally, consider the provider's customer service and ease of program administration.

3. Determining Gift Card Values

The value of gift cards can vary depending on the program and the company's budget. Some companies opt for fixed-value gift cards, while others may provide a range of values based on the employee's performance or tenure. It's crucial to strike a balance between providing meaningful rewards and staying within the allocated budget.

4. Distribution and Redemption

Once the gift cards are selected and their values determined, they can be distributed to employees. This can be done physically or electronically, depending on the program's logistics and the employee's preferences. Employees can then redeem their gift cards at their chosen retailers or online platforms, using them to purchase items or services of their choice.

5. Program Tracking and Reporting

To ensure the success and effectiveness of the gift card program, it is important to track and report on its usage. This can be done by monitoring redemption rates, analyzing feedback from employees, and measuring the impact on employee engagement and satisfaction. Regular monitoring allows companies to make data-driven decisions and make improvements as needed.

Types of Gift Cards

Giftpack smart egift card for 350 brands for Employee Gift Card Programs

When it comes to employee gift card programs, retailer-specific gift cards are a popular choice. These cards provide employees with the opportunity to choose from a wide range of products and services offered by a specific retailer. Whether it's a department store, a clothing brand, or a restaurant chain, these gift cards allow employees to indulge in their personal preferences.

The advantage of retailer-specific gift cards lies in the flexibility they offer. Employees can select a gift card that aligns with their interests and preferences. For instance, if an employee is a fashion enthusiast, they can choose a gift card for a trendy clothing store to update their wardrobe. On the other hand, a food lover might prefer a gift card for a popular restaurant chain.

Prepaid Debit Cards: Empowering Employees with Financial Freedom

Prepaid debit cards are another type of gift card commonly offered in employee gift card programs. These cards come loaded with a specific amount of money that employees can spend wherever debit cards are accepted. They provide employees with the freedom to choose their own rewards, whether it's purchasing groceries, paying bills, or treating themselves to a special treat.

The advantage of prepaid debit cards is that they allow employees to have control over their spending. Instead of being limited to a specific retailer, they can use the card wherever they desire. This versatility empowers employees to make choices that best suit their needs, enabling them to feel a sense of financial freedom.

Digital Gift Cards: The Modern Solution for the Tech-Savvy Workforce

In today's digitally-driven world, digital gift cards are gaining popularity in employee gift card programs. These cards are delivered electronically, typically via email or mobile apps, allowing employees to conveniently access their rewards on their smartphones or computers. Digital gift cards can be redeemed for products, services, or experiences.

The advantage of digital gift cards lies in their convenience and speed. Employees can receive their rewards instantly, eliminating the need for physical cards to be shipped or collected. Digital gift cards also offer the flexibility of being stored and used digitally, reducing the risk of loss or damage.

What Is An Appropriate Gift Card Amount for Employees?

Giftpack Smart eGift Card for Employee Gift Card Programs

When it comes to establishing employee gift card programs, determining the most appropriate gift card amount can be a challenging task. The goal is to strike a balance between motivating and rewarding your employees without breaking the bank. In this section, we will explore different factors to consider when deciding on the right gift card amount for your employees.

1. Consider the Average Salary Level

One crucial factor to consider is the average salary level of your employees. It is important to ensure that the gift card amount is meaningful and valued by your employees. For example, if you have a workforce with a higher average salary, a larger gift card amount may be more fitting to demonstrate appreciation for their hard work and dedication.

2. Align the Gift Card Amount with Performance Goals

Another approach to determine an appropriate gift card amount is to align it with performance goals. Consider setting specific targets for your employees, and reward them with gift cards based on their achievements. This approach helps to foster a culture of continuous improvement and motivation within the workplace.

3. Take into Account the Occasion or Reason for the Gift Card

The occasion or reason for the gift card can also influence the appropriate amount. For instance, if the gift card is given as a holiday bonus, a larger amount may be more suitable to celebrate the festive season and show appreciation for their year-round efforts. On the other hand, if the gift card is part of a quarterly recognition program, a smaller amount may be sufficient to acknowledge and reward their performance.

4. Consider the Cost of Living in the Area

The cost of living can vary significantly depending on the location of your business. It is essential to consider the local cost of living when determining the appropriate gift card amount. Adjusting the gift card amount to reflect the local economy ensures that it is perceived as a meaningful reward by your employees.

5. Seek Employee Feedback

Lastly, employee feedback is invaluable when deciding on the appropriate gift card amount. Conduct surveys or hold informal discussions to gather input from your employees. This approach not only helps you gauge their preferences and expectations but also makes them feel valued and involved in the decision-making process.

Measuring The Success of An Employee Gift Card Program

When it comes to boosting employee morale and driving overall business outcomes, employee gift card programs can be a powerful tool. However, in order to truly understand their effectiveness, companies need to have a way to measure their success and impact. By identifying key performance indicators (KPIs) that are relevant in this context, businesses can gain valuable insights into the effectiveness of their gift card programs. Let's explore some of these KPIs and how they can be used to measure success.

1. Employee Satisfaction

One of the most important factors to consider when measuring the success of an employee gift card program is employee satisfaction. This can be measured through employee surveys, focus groups, or one-on-one interviews. By gauging employee satisfaction, companies can understand if their gift card program is positively impacting morale and motivation within the organization.

2. Employee Engagement

Employee engagement is another crucial KPI to consider. Companies can measure engagement by tracking metrics such as employee participation in program activities, the number of employees redeeming their gift cards, and overall program adoption rates. Higher levels of engagement indicate that employees are actively participating in the program and finding value in the gift card rewards.

3. Retention Rates

A key business outcome that can be influenced by employee gift card programs is employee retention. By analyzing retention rates, businesses can determine if their gift card program is helping to keep employees satisfied and motivated. Lower turnover rates indicate that employees are more likely to stay with the company, which can lead to cost savings and increased productivity.

4. Productivity

Tracking productivity levels before and after implementing an employee gift card program can provide insights into its impact on overall business outcomes. Companies can analyze metrics such as sales revenue, customer satisfaction scores, or project completion rates to determine if there is a positive correlation between the program and increased productivity.

5. Cost Savings

Another important KPI to consider is cost savings. By comparing the cost of the gift card program to potential savings in recruitment and training expenses due to reduced turnover, companies can determine if the program is delivering a positive return on investment. Additionally, businesses can consider the cost of employee disengagement and the potential cost savings associated with increased productivity.

6. Customer Satisfaction

Employee gift card programs can also indirectly impact customer satisfaction. By measuring customer satisfaction scores, companies can determine if there is a correlation between employee morale and customer experiences. Satisfied employees are more likely to provide exceptional service, which can result in higher customer satisfaction levels and increased customer loyalty.
